Transaction 8667919f8122798efc6d3bebff6193cf832b978cdae7c5b516d6116b175ece0e
1 Input
1 Output
-
8667919f8122798efc6d3bebff6193cf832b978cdae7c5b516d6116b175ece0e:0
- value
- 1318733
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 179381de129913eb1b38cb2269ef752ffa2a5cb5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 139fFQ7xWk1FYp8bVuisaEEET1miTSHwzQ